Do I need to have Microsoft Word installed to export to a Microsoft Word format?
That seems ludicrous, but an error message suggests it is true.
I can convert Word documents into PDF using TextEdit/OpenOffice/etc. I don't need Word. But Flare somehow NEEDS MSWord in order to do its export?
If the answer is “yes,†can anyone think of any way I can produce PDFs if I do not own Microsoft Word or Framemaker?

Re: Uh Oh... (Microsoft Word Target not working)
And you need Word 2007 to be able to create a PDF directly from Flare.
As for other methods of creating PDFs... I have Adobe Acrobat, so I open the Word output and generate the PDF from there using the Acrobat plug-in. If you don't have Acrobat, there are other (free) programs available for creating PDFs.

Re: Uh Oh... (Microsoft Word Target not working)
FYI... It clearly states in the system requirements (http://kb.madcapsoftware.com/default_CSH.htm#FlareTop1) that you need Word 2003 SP2 (Flare v1 and higher) or Framemaker 6 or higher (Flare v2 and higher) for printed output.

Re: Uh Oh... (Microsoft Word Target not working)
Keep in mind that the .doc format is a proprietary, binary format that others emulate as good as possible (OpenOffice.org for example), but it really is Microsoft's fault for crushing any competition and other formats and then not coming forward with specs about what they use. While that may be the way to rake in more cash for Microsoft it makes it just more troublesome for everyone else, as you case clearly shows. PDF is also proprietary, but Adobe generally publishes enough maintained information about the format so that others can use it (FoxIT, OpenOffice.org, and yes, Word 2007 as well). It shows that using proprietary formats is not a smart thing. Unfortunately, MadCap decided not so support the only broadly implemented, open, XML based, ISO certified document format: ODF. With ODF Flare could generate the printable output without any additional software needed and after downloading OOo one could create PDFs. So, MadCap, when do we finally get ODF support? Or do we really have to go out and by MS Office and wait for the service pack to generate ODF from Flare projects?

Re: Uh Oh... (Microsoft Word Target not working)
Flare needs word in order to create the DOC files, Also Flare needs Word in order to import Word files also. Flare use Word to import the DOC files, as it saves it as XML and them import XML into your Flare project
